The first hour sets the tone

People tend to underestimate water. They mop, set out a fan, and figure sunny weather will take care of the rest. It rarely does. Hygroscopic building materials, especially drywall and oriented strand board, absorb water and share it along their fibers. Cavities trap humid air. Flooring underlayments hold moisture like a sponge. If you miss hidden wet spots, you invite buckling, delamination, odors, and mold growth that can emerge 48 to 72 hours after a loss.

The first hour is triage. Shut off the water. Make the area safe. Document conditions for insurance. Then start controlled extraction and establish a drying plan. A well-equipped water damage restoration company brings not only extractors and air movers, but also meters, thermal imaging, containment materials, and the judgment earned by seeing a hundred slightly different versions of the same problem.

What professional mitigation looks like, step by step

Elandon Restoration Services Inc treats every call like a unique job because the causes and building assemblies aren’t the same from house to house. Still, the underlying sequence remains consistent.

Arrival and safety check. Before anything else, ensure electrical safety. If water has reached outlets, baseboard heaters, or a breaker panel, power may need to be cut to affected zones. Slip hazards are addressed. Furniture is blocked or moved to prevent stain transfer and secondary damage.

Cause of loss identified and stopped. It sounds obvious, but it bears stating. A pinhole in copper behind a dishwasher is different from a failed wax ring at a toilet or a storm-driven roof leak. Source control can mean shutting a valve, tarping a roof, or coordinating a plumber.

Documentation for claims. Good restoration professionals take wide shots and close-ups, note moisture readings, and capture the path of water migration. That baseline helps the adjuster align on scope and gives you a clear picture of what is wet, what is at risk, and what needs to happen next. It also protects you from under-scoping, which is how lingering problems are born.

Extraction, then targeted demolition. You cannot dry what you do not remove. Carpet and pad come up if saturated, though sometimes carpet can be floated and saved depending on age and fiber type. Baseboards are gently pried to allow air exchange behind walls. On heavily affected walls, flood cuts at 12 to 24 inches let trapped moisture and air move. The goal is always to remove the minimum necessary while ensuring a complete dry.

Drying and dehumidification. Air movement without humidity control is just a breeze. Proper drying uses a balanced ratio of air movers and dehumidifiers configured for the volume of air, the class of water, and the permeance of affected materials. Technicians chart daily moisture readings in studs, sill plates, and flooring, not just in the air. When readings trend toward equilibrium with unaffected areas, equipment is reduced and then removed.

Cleaning and antimicrobial measures. After mitigation, surfaces are cleaned and, where appropriate, treated with EPA-registered antimicrobials. This is not a cure-all spray. It complements physical drying and removal. If an area has active microbial growth, the response becomes more controlled, including containment and negative air.

Repair and rebuild. Once dry, the space is ready for reconstruction. That might mean reinstalling baseboards, painting, replacing sections of drywall, resetting doors that swelled, or flooring repairs. The best outcomes come when the same team that mitigated also coordinates the rebuild, since they know exactly what came out and why.

Where water hides, and how to find it

Moisture is sneaky. It follows seams and fasteners and picks the path of least resistance. In two-story homes, water from an upstairs bath can track along joists and appear in a ceiling far from the source. Behind the scenes, capillary action can draw water feet above the visible water line. I have seen sill plates that seemed dry at the surface but tested wet at depth.

Finding hidden moisture requires tools and habits. Thermal cameras are invaluable, not because they see moisture directly, but because temperature differences often reveal wet areas evaporatively cooling. Pin-type moisture meters confirm those suspect spots, and pinless meters quickly survey large surfaces. In older homes with lath and plaster, readings require interpretation, because dense materials read differently than drywall. In crawlspace homes around Cartersville, vented spaces can present higher ambient humidity in summer, which complicates the dry-down unless you isolate and condition the area. Experience helps distinguish a cold air gap from a saturated stud bay.

Categories of water and why they matter

Restoration protocols follow industry standards that differentiate water by contamination rather than clarity. A clean supply line leak generally starts as Category 1 water, meaning it poses minimal health risk at first contact. If it flows across soiled carpet, picks up pet dander, or sits for more than a day, it often degrades to Category 2, sometimes called grey water. A toilet overflow that includes urine, or a dishwasher discharge, typically lands here from the start.

Category 3 water, or black water, includes sewage, rising groundwater, and floodwater from outdoors. This category requires more aggressive removal of affected porous materials and more stringent PPE and containment. I have seen well-meaning homeowners try to bleach and fan their way through a sewage backup. It looks better for a week, then the odor returns because contaminated materials inside walls and cavities remained. The distinction among categories is not academic. It governs what you can safely clean and save, what must be removed, and how the space is sanitized.

Drying goals and the science behind “done”

You are not done when the carpet feels dry to the touch. You are done when moisture in structural materials returns to acceptable ranges and the environment is stable. In Cartersville, outside summer dew points often sit high. If you open windows and rely on hot, humid air to “dry” a house, you can stall or reverse the process.

Drying strategy rests on three levers: temperature, airflow, and humidity. Warm air holds more moisture, moving air helps lift moisture from surfaces, and dehumidifiers remove that moisture from the air. In a typical living room with soaked drywall and baseboards, a technician might position centrifugal air movers every 10 to 16 linear feet along walls, angle them to create a clockwise airflow pattern, and place a low-grain refrigerant dehumidifier sized to the cubic footage. Daily readings drive adjustments. If an area plateaus, it might need a small bore cut to ventilate a cavity, or it might require pulling an additional baseboard to relieve pressure.

There is also the question of material sensitivity. Hardwood floors can be salvaged if addressed quickly. They often crown or cup when boards dry unevenly. Sufficient dehumidification and panel mats can pull moisture down from within the boards. If you try to refinish too early, sanding can telegraph the cupping. Patience and data avoid that mistake.

Insurance, scope, and practical timelines

Homeowners often ask how long drying takes and what it will cost. The honest answer depends on the size of the affected area, the materials, the category of water, and how quickly mitigation starts. Many Category 1 residential losses stabilize within three to five days of active drying. Category 2 and 3 events, or losses that sat unnoticed, can stretch a week or more, especially if demolition is needed.

On cost, reputable firms use standardized estimating platforms that apply regional pricing for labor and materials. The key is setting the scope accurately. If a dining room and adjacent hallway are wet, but the contractor only scopes the visible dining room, the hallway will become the comeback. Insurers focus on “like kind and quality” and returning the property to pre-loss condition. Good documentation supports your claim and reduces friction.

There is also the matter of contents. Some items clean and dry well. Upholstery can be tricky, especially if seams trapped contaminated water. Disassembly and specialized drying may be worthwhile for sentimental or high-value pieces. Books and documents are salvageable with freeze-drying, but that requires quick action and careful packaging.

Local realities in Cartersville, GA

Cartersville’s climate factors into mitigation choices. Summer humidity can sit high, which argues for closed drying systems with dehumidification rather than open windows. Spring storms can overwhelm gutters and downspouts, pushing water against foundation walls, then into basements or crawlspaces. After a heavy rain, I have seen sump pumps run continuously, only to fail under load and flood a basement with several inches of water within an hour.

Many homes in the area are built on crawlspaces. These present unique challenges. Standing water below the house complicates drying above. Vapor barriers might be torn or missing. Fiberglass insulation can absorb and hold water, sagging from cavities and creating pockets that feed microbial growth. In those cases, a thorough approach includes pumping and drying the crawlspace, replacing wet insulation, addressing the vapor barrier, and sometimes improving drainage. Skipping the crawlspace is a shortcut that reintroduces moisture to living spaces as soon as the equipment leaves.

Health considerations you should not ignore

Mold is often the first fear people voice, sometimes with good reason. water damage restoration Cartersville GA elandonrestoration.com Mold spores are ubiquitous, and given moisture and time, they colonize. What people forget is that bacterial amplification, VOCs from wet materials, and the stress of a disrupted home can matter just as much. If someone in the household is immunocompromised, a conservative approach to removal and containment might make sense even for a Category 1 event that lingered.

PPE is not just for sewage jobs. Cutting into wet drywall releases dust and fibers. Negative air machines and containment reduce cross-contamination. In multi-unit buildings, that containment also respects neighbors who share walls or hallways.

Prevention and maintenance that pay off

Not all water losses are preventable, but many are catchable earlier. A few habits reduce risk more than any gadget. Walk your home with fresh eyes twice a year. Look under sinks for mineral trails on supply lines, feel around shutoff valves, check behind the fridge and below the dishwasher for soft flooring or discoloration, and scan ceilings for faint rings after storms. Clean gutters and confirm downspouts discharge several feet from the foundation. In crawlspace homes, peek in after a heavy rain. If you see standing water or fallen insulation, address it before it becomes an indoor problem.

Smart leak sensors help. Place them under the washing machine, at the water heater pan, and below kitchen and bath vanities. They are inexpensive and loud. If you travel, consider a shutoff valve that closes automatically when it detects unusual flow. I have seen water heaters fail two months after the warranty expired. A sensor and shutoff turned a potential catastrophe into a small puddle.

What to do before the pros arrive

While you wait for a team like Elandon Restoration Services Inc to arrive, a few actions can limit damage. Prioritize safety. If water approaches outlets or the breaker panel, do not step in. If safe, shut off the main water supply. Move small valuables and electronics to a dry, elevated area. Place aluminum foil or plastic under furniture legs to prevent staining. Do not pull up carpet unless advised, because you can tear backing and complicate reinstallation. Resist the urge to deploy household fans without dehumidification. You can spread moisture to unaffected rooms if you do.

Craft matters in the rebuild

Mitigation gets you dry. Rebuild gets you back to normal. The quality of repair work is visible every day. Matching texture on a ceiling patch, aligning new baseboards with existing profiles, feathering paint to avoid flashing, and reinstalling trim with the same reveal are details that separate a good job from a reminder that you had a loss. Timing also matters. Wood that is not fully dry can shrink after painting, revealing seams and nail pops. Patience saves repainting.

Flooring choices require judgment. Engineered wood can be forgiving, depending on the core and finish. Solid hardwood tolerates sanding and refinishing if moisture content is brought down gradually. Laminate rarely survives saturation because the core swells. Tile often cleans up well, but wet thinset and damp backer boards beneath need verification. I have seen grout lines look perfect while water still sat in the underlayment. A day saved in drying can cost months later if tiles debond.
